If a cell in range of cells in Excel 2010 contains specific text, move whole cell text into a different column

I am struggling to find an answer to this one...

Each month I am provided with a spreadsheet full of clients data that is a raw extract from some sort of CRM software and that data is a mess. Some cells are merged, some are not. When you unmerge the whole sheet, you end up with data that is meant for one column randomly spread across 3 columns and mixed with another data, ie email addresses are spread across 3 columns and mixed with postcodes.

What I'd like to be able to do is search for cells within columns S, T and U that contain "@" and move (not copy) the whole email address to column V on the same row.

How can I achieve that?

You can achieve this with the following formula into V1:

=INDEX(S1:U1,MATCH(TRUE,NOT(ISERROR(SEARCH("@",S1:U1))),0))

The formula needs to be entered as array formula, ie pressing Ctrl - Shift - Enter .

Press Alt+F11 to open the Visual Basic Editor, and then click Insert, Module. Paste this in. Or, just download the example file here . Then under View/Macros, this movemail() routine will be there. Run it.

Sub moveemail()

Dim ws As Worksheet
Dim thisCell As Range, nextCell As Range, lookAt As Range
Dim foundAt As String, lookFor As String
Dim lastRow As Long
lookFor = "@"
On Error GoTo Err

'get last populated cell
Set ws = Application.ActiveSheet
With ws
    If WorksheetFunction.CountA(Cells) > 0 Then
        lastRow = Cells.Find(what:="*", SearchOrder:=xlByRows, _
        SearchDirection:=xlPrevious).Row
    End If
End With

' go cell by cell looking for @ from row 1 to row 10000
Set lookAt = ActiveSheet.Range("S1:U" & lastRow)
Set thisCell = lookAt.Find(what:=lookFor, LookIn:=xlValues, lookAt:=xlPart, SearchDirection:=xlNext)
    If Not thisCell Is Nothing Then
        Set nextCell = thisCell
        Do
            Set thisCell = lookAt.FindNext(After:=thisCell)
            If Not thisCell Is Nothing Then
                foundAt = thisCell.Address

                            thisCell.Copy Range("V" & thisCell.Row)
                            thisCell.ClearContents
            Else
                Exit Do
            End If
            If thisCell.Address = nextCell.Address Then Exit Do
        Loop
    Else
        'MsgBox SearchString & " not Found"
        Exit Sub
    End If
Err:
    'MsgBox Err.Number
    Exit Sub
End Sub
